温馨提示×

mybatis怎么开启查询日志打印

小亿
530
2024-01-25 12:44:29
栏目: 编程语言

要开启MyBatis的查询日志打印,可以通过配置MyBatis的日志实现类来实现。以下是一种常用的方式:

  1. 在MyBatis的配置文件(通常是mybatis-config.xml)中添加以下配置:
<configuration> <!-- 其他配置 --> <!-- 开启日志 --> <settings> <setting name="logImpl" value="STDOUT_LOGGING" /> </settings> </configuration> 
  1. 在项目的依赖中添加相应的日志框架依赖,例如使用Logback作为日志框架:
<dependencies> <!-- 其他依赖 --> <!-- Logback日志框架依赖 --> <dependency> <groupId>ch.qos.logback</groupId> <artifactId>logback-classic</artifactId> <version>1.2.3</version> </dependency> </dependencies> 
  1. 在项目的日志配置文件(例如logback.xml)中添加相应的配置,例如:
<configuration> <!-- 其他配置 --> <!-- 配置MyBatis日志输出 --> <logger name="org.mybatis" level="DEBUG" /> <!-- 其他日志配置 --> </configuration> 

这样配置后,MyBatis会将查询的SQL语句以及相关的日志信息打印到日志文件或控制台中。

0